Question
the political affiliation of chiles president in 1970, salvador allende, is best described as \
liberal. \
conservative. \
communist. \
socialist.
Brief Explanations
Salvador Allende, Chile's president in 1970, was a socialist. He led the Popular Unity coalition and his political ideology and actions (like nationalizing industries) aligned with socialist principles. Liberal and conservative don't match his political stance, and while he had connections with communists, his primary affiliation was socialist.
